Green Coatings: Fighting Corrosion, Protecting Our Planet

The infrastructure industry is increasingly embracing green coatings as a sustainable solution to combat corrosion and minimize environmental impact. These innovative coatings utilize eco-friendly materials, reducing the reliance on harmful chemicals traditionally used in protective films. By minimizing VOC emissions, these coatings contribute to improved air quality and reduce greenhouse gas emissions, playing a crucial role in protecting our planet. Furthermore, green coatings often possess exceptional durability and longevity, requiring less frequent application, thereby conserving resources and minimizing waste generation.

  • Green coatings offer a sustainable alternative to traditional paints.
  • Their eco-friendly formulation reduces environmental impact throughout their lifecycle.
  • These coatings contribute to improved air quality and lower greenhouse gas emissions.
  • With enhanced durability, green coatings minimize the need for frequent replacements.
